Bolivia vs Andorra Match Analysis & Prediction
26/03/2024 12:00 am
Bolivia will go head-to-head with European underdogs Andorra in a friendly game at Stade du 19 Mai 1956 in Algeria on Monday.
The South Americans have won just one of their previous 10 internationals, while the Tricolors are winless in 14 matches.
Bolivia already face an almighty task to secure their place at the 2026 World Cup, having lost five of their six qualifying matches.
With their next qualifier set to take place in November, Bolivia have turned their attention to preparations for the Copa America in the USA this summer.
Bolivia looked set to begin their build-up to the tournament with a victory after taking a 2-1 lead in Friday’s friendly with Algeria, only to concede two goals in the final 15 minutes to suffer a 3-2 defeat.
Having now gone four friendly matches without a victory, La Verde will be determined to pick up a confidence-boosting win in their first-ever encounter with Andorra.
Andorra have drawn four and lost 10 of their 14 matches since beating Liechtenstein 2-0 in a UEFA Nations League game in September 2022.
Ten of those matches took place in Euro 2024 qualifying, where Andorra finished bottom of Group I with just two points on the board.
After losing their final six matches of qualifying, Koldo Alvarez’s side would have been relieved to end that run with a 1-1 draw in Thursday’s friendly with South Africa.
Cucu opened the scoring in the fifth minute to register Andorra’s first goal since they got on the scoresheet in a 2-1 defeat to Israel in June 2023.
Although Elias Mokwana’s equaliser ensured the game finished all square, Andorra have managed to avoid defeat in four of their last six friendlies, giving them a source of inspiration for Monday’s encounter with Bolivia.

Bolivia Team News
Bolivia manager Antonio Carlos Zago may take the opportunity to rotate his squad for the second game of the current international window.
Rodrigo Ramallo, Moises Villarroel and Miguelito are among those who could be considered for a starting spot.

Andorra Team News
Andorra midfielder Jordi Alaez is a doubt for Monday’s contest after he was forced off in the first half against South Africa.
Eric de Pablos replaced Alaez in the 1-1 draw, and he could be presented with a starting opportunity if the 26-year-old is unable to take his place in the side.
